Dr. Stelios Rekkas is a fellowship-trained bariatric and general surgeon (FACS, FASMBS) who leads Manatee Weight Loss Center / Manatee Surgical Alliance in Bradenton, FL, and serves as Director of Bariatric Surgery at Manatee Memorial Hospital. A Manatee County native raised on Anna Maria Island, he graduated with high honors from the University of Florida, earned his medical degree at Florida State University College of Medicine, completed his general surgery residency at Mount Sinai Medical Center, and finished a fellowship in minimally invasive, bariatric, and robotic surgery at Jackson Hospital in Miami. With roughly two decades of experience, he is one of the higher-volume robotic bariatric surgeons in the region, performing sleeve gastrectomy and bariatric procedures more often than typical peers and operating extensively on the da Vinci platform. His robotic expertise is significant enough that Intuitive designates him a robotic surgical proctor, meaning he trains other surgeons across the country. Beyond weight-loss surgery, his general-surgery practice includes procedures such as gallbladder and colon surgery, serving the broader Bradenton-Sarasota-Lakewood Ranch market.
